A high-society wedding party stirs up new evidence in an unsolved murder in this explosive and twisting thriller from the number one bestselling co-author of James Patterson's Michael Bennett. When Terry Rourke is invited to the spare-no-expense beach wedding of his hedge fund manager brother, he thinks that his biggest worry will be flubbing the champagne toast. But this isn't the first time Terry has been to the Hamptons. As the designer tuxedos are laid out and the flowers arranged along the glittering surf, Terry can't help but take another look at a decades-old murder trial that rocked the very foundations of the town - and his family. He soon learns that digging up billion-dollar sand can be a very dangerous activity. The kind of danger that can very quickly turn even the most beautiful beach wedding into a wake.

JAMES PATTERSON 'Sizzles with tension and twists' STEVE BERRY It's summer in New York City and Faye Walker has it all. She's not only scored one of the most highly coveted internships in all of Wall Street, she's also just met the head-over-heels love of her life. With her natural-born gift for numbers and a work ethic that knows no bounds, Faye is a shoo-in for a full-time position at the illustrious merchant bank, Greene Brothers Hale. Then, just as she awaits her offer and her signing bonus, a treacherous betrayal arrives to shatter Faye's plans and her young life. But what her high finance masters-of-the-universe bosses don't know is that Faye isn't like any of the other interns. Having made her way past her humble small-town beginnings, for Faye, going back is not an option. That's why Faye now has a new plan. One that involves Swiss watch timing, nerves of steel and ten million dollars in cold hard Wall Street cash...

THE TIMES 'Great storytelling' JAMES PATTERSON Ex-Navy Seal Mike Gannon - a man used to being in the firing line - has always wanted to travel to Alaska. So when the opportunity for a bucket-list trip to the northern wilds comes up, he doesn't hesitate to take it. However, he soon discovers other hunters are already there...and he's in their targets. Soon Gannon finds himself caught and captured, forced onto a private jet bound for an unknown destination. He may not know who took him or why, but he's certain that lethal danger awaits. Those determined to hold Gannon seem to have all the power. But they have overlooked one simple thing: some men can be intimidated but others will never break.
A CRIME LORD IS ON THE LOOSE-AND HE'S DECLARED WAR ON DETECTIVE
MICHAEL BENNETT'S FAMILY. Manuel Perrine doesn't fear anyone or
anything. A charismatic, ruthless strongman, Perrine slaughters
rivals as effortlessly as he wears his trademark white linen suits.
Detective Michael Bennett is the only U.S. official ever to succeed
in putting Perrine behind bars. But now Perrine is out-and vows to
find and kill Bennett and everyone dear to him. Bennett and his ten
adopted children are living on a secluded California farm, guarded
by the FBI's witness protection program. Soon Perrine begins a
campaign of assassinations, brazenly slaughtering powerful
individuals across the country. The FBI has no clue where Perrine
is hiding or how he is orchestrating his attacks. It is forced to
ask Bennett to risk it all-his career, his family, his own life-to
fight Perrine's war on America. With intensity, speed, and
explosive action rivaling James Bond movies at their best-and
featuring one of the most complex and chilling villains ever
created-GONE is the newest astounding novel by James
Patterson.

THE TIMES When a private jet crashes into the Caribbean sea, diving instructor Michael Gannon is the only person on the scene. Finding six dead men and a suitcase full of cash and diamonds, Gannon assumes he's the beneficiary of a drug deal gone wrong. However, it seems one of the passengers was the Director of the FBI - despite the official story that he died of natural causes in Italy. Suddenly pursued by a shadowy cabal of the world's most powerful and dangerous men, Gannon will only survive if he unravels a terrifying conspiracy. But those determined to kill him will learn that Gannon's past holds its own deadly secrets...and the hunters soon become the prey. For thirty-six years, James Patterson has written unputdownable, pulse-racing novels. Now, he has written a book that surpasses all of them. Zoo is the thriller he was born to write. All over the world, brutal attacks are crippling entire cities. Jackson Oz, a young biologist, watches the escalating events with an increasing sense of dread. When he witnesses a coordinated lion ambush in Africa, the enormity of the violence to come becomes terrifyingly clear. With the help of ecologist Chloe Tousignant, Oz races to warn world leaders before it's too late. The attacks are growing in ferocity, cunning, and planning, and soon there will be no place left for humans to hide. With wildly inventive imagination and white-knuckle suspense that rivals Stephen King at his very best, James Patterson's Zoo is an epic, non-stop thrill-ride.
